19 For he has oppressed and forsaken the poor; he has seized houses he did not build.
20 Because his appetite is never satisfied, he cannot escape with his treasure.
21 Nothing is left for him to consume; thus his prosperity will not endure.
22 In the midst of his plenty, he will be distressed; the full force of misery will come upon him.
23 When he has filled his stomach, God will vent His fury upon him, raining it down on him as he eats.
24 Though he flees from an iron weapon, a bronze-tipped arrow will pierce him.
25 It is drawn out of his back, the gleaming point from his liver. Terrors come over him.
26 Total darkness is reserved for his treasures. A fire unfanned will consume him and devour what is left in his tent.
27 The heavens will expose his iniquity, and the earth will rise up against him.
28 The possessions of his house will be removed, flowing away on the day of God’s wrath.
29 This is the wicked man’s portion from God, the inheritance God has appointed him.”
